5:33Yeah, so the um when they come in and apply for their liquor license at that time our business license official will verify distancing standards based on state requirements.
5:46Um that will go to the city council as a uh local consent item.
5:51Um so the actual liquor license won't come before you.
5:55Um there is a bar license available with the city through the business license uh standards, and for my understanding, this property does meet the distancing standards.

15:54Um so Tuesday for Bangater Crossroads, uh, zoning map and land use map amendments, as well as the open shaw zoning and land use map amendments.
16:05Um City Council did approve those.
16:08Um the ordinance was set the ordinance that would actually change the the zoning that was approved, sets it so that it doesn't take effect until May 7th, um, and it requires the applicants to come in with a development agreement.
16:24So they have to make that development agreement application before the end of the year.
16:29Um and then that gives us five months, well, four months to really kind of work through that process, have those public hearings, bring it to planning commission council, and get something approved for the development agreement before the zoning takes effect.
